fix: exclude __words__ keyword index from corruption detection and getStats()

The __words__ keyword index stores 50-5000 entries per entity (one per
word), which inflated avg entries/entity well above the corruption
threshold of 100. This caused:

1. validateConsistency() to falsely detect corruption on every startup,
   triggering unnecessary clearAllIndexData() + rebuild() cycles
2. getStats() to log false "Metadata index may be corrupted" warnings
   and report inflated totalEntries/totalIds stats

Both methods now skip __words__ when counting, so stats and health
checks reflect metadata fields only (noun, type, createdAt, etc.).
Keyword search is unaffected since the __words__ field index itself
is not modified.
